AI Summary

  • Requires money services licensees and currency exchange licensees to register with the Nationwide Multistate Licensing System and Registry and maintain a valid unique identifier.

  • Establishes surety bond requirements of $25,000 to $1,000,000 for money transmission and currency exchange licenses, covering claims for at least five years after licensee stops providing services.

  • Authorizes money services licensees to contract with other licensees to use existing authorized delegates as subdelegates to load funds onto open-loop stored-value cards.

  • Increases record retention requirements from three years to five years for payment instruments and stored-value obligations, and extends reporting deadlines for material events to one business day.

  • Adds comprehensive definitions and compliance requirements for virtual currency business activities and expands exemptions to include insurance companies, title insurance companies, and attorneys conducting money transmission or currency exchange as ancillary services.
